The Entrepreneurs' Organization of Cincinnati has named the inaugural cohort for its in-house accelerator program, while also welcoming a new president.
The group — which first announced plans to launch an accelerator a year ago — announced six companies will make up the program. Those companies include:
- American Legacy Tours
- Anchor Wellness
- Lia’s Landscaping
- Pomme Communications
- Queen City Data
- Quanta
The accelerator is aimed at helping startups grow their revenues to more than $1 million annually, a requirement for EO membership. The program will tap into the EO's network of entrepreneurs to provide participants mentors and offer learning events.
Separately, the organization announced Chris Mann, owner of the Woodhouse Day Spas, has taken over as its president for a one-year term. He replaces Jim Salters, co-founder of CEO Accelerators.
